    +/**
    + * Base class for key/value state implementations that are backed by a 
regular heap hash map. The
    + * concrete implementations define how the state is checkpointed.
    + * 
    + * @param <K> The type of the key.
    + * @param <V> The type of the value.
    + * @param <Backend> The type of the backend that snapshots this key/value 
state.
    + */
    +public abstract class AbstractHeapKvState<K, V, Backend extends 
StateBackend<Backend>> implements KvState<K, V, Backend> {
    +
    +   /** Map containing the actual key/value pairs */
    +   private final HashMap<K, V> state;
    +   
    +   /** The serializer for the keys */
    +   private final TypeSerializer<K> keySerializer;
    +
    +   /** The serializer for the values */
    +   private final TypeSerializer<V> valueSerializer;
    +   
    +   /** The value that is returned when no other value has been associated 
with a key, yet */
    +   private final V defaultValue;
    +   
    +   /** The current key, which the next value methods will refer to */
    +   private K currentKey;
    +   
    +   /**
    +    * Creates a new empty key/value state.
    +    * 
    +    * @param keySerializer The serializer for the keys.
    +    * @param valueSerializer The serializer for the values.
    +    * @param defaultValue The value that is returned when no other value 
has been associated with a key, yet.
    +    */
    +   protected AbstractHeapKvState(TypeSerializer<K> keySerializer,
    +                                                                   
TypeSerializer<V> valueSerializer,
    +                                                                   V 
defaultValue) {
    +           this(keySerializer, valueSerializer, defaultValue, new 
HashMap<K, V>());
    +   }
    +
    +   /**
    +    * Creates a new key/value state for the given hash map of key/value 
pairs.
    +    * 
    +    * @param keySerializer The serializer for the keys.
    +    * @param valueSerializer The serializer for the values.
    +    * @param defaultValue The value that is returned when no other value 
has been associated with a key, yet.
    +    * @param state The state map to use in this kev/value state. May 
contain initial state.   
    +    */
    +   protected AbstractHeapKvState(TypeSerializer<K> keySerializer,
    +                                                                   
TypeSerializer<V> valueSerializer,
    +                                                                   V 
defaultValue,
    +                                                                   
HashMap<K, V> state) {
    +           this.state = requireNonNull(state);
    +           this.keySerializer = requireNonNull(keySerializer);
    +           this.valueSerializer = requireNonNull(valueSerializer);
    +           this.defaultValue = defaultValue;
    +   }
    +
    +   // 
------------------------------------------------------------------------
    +   
    +   @Override
    +   public V value() {
    +           V value = state.get(currentKey);
    +           return value != null ? value : defaultValue;
    --- End diff --
    
    I think you should make a copy of the default value here. Otherwise you end 
up with the same objects for non primitive types.
